Drug Application (NDA) is the vehicle through which drug sponsors
The New Drug Application (NDA) is the vehicle through which drug sponsors formally propose that the FDA approve a new pharmaceutical for sale and marketing in the United States.The purpose of a NDA is to provide enough information to permit the FDA to reach the following key decisions Whether the drug is safe and effective in its proposed use(s), and whether the benefits of the drug outweigh the risks Whether the drug’s proposed labeling (package insert) is appropriate and what it should contain Whether the methods used in manufacturing the drug and the controls used to maintain the drug’s quality are adequate to preserve the drug’s identity, strength, quality, and purity For more information on new drug applications, please visit the FDA’s How drugs are developed and approved page.
